How Earl Torgeson's Isolated Power Compares to Similar Players
Earl Torgeson posted a career Isolated Power of .152, above the league average of .128 — production that kept him consistently ahead of most peers. His best Isolated Power season came in 1958, posting .202, well above the league average of .146 that year. The lowest point came in 1961 at .000, well below the league average of .147 that year, a partial season. Production slipped through the final seasons. The figure moved from .137 in 1959 to .140 in 1960 and .000 in 1961.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. Significant season-to-season variance characterizes the Isolated Power profile — ranging from .000 to .202 — though the career average remained above league norms.
